SUPERtrol-I RS-485 Option with Modbus RTU Protocol

Similar documents
The Answer to the 14 Most Frequently Asked Modbus Questions

Modbus and ION Technology

Modbus and ION Technology

Modbus Communications for PanelView Terminals

Different Ways of Connecting to. 3DLevelScanner II. A.P.M Automation Solutions LTD. Version 3.0

Softstarters. Type PSTX Fieldbus communication, Built-in Modbus RTU. 1SFC132089M0201 April SFC132089M0201 1

RS-485 Protocol Manual

Introduction: Implementation of the MVI56-MCM module for modbus communications:

4511 MODBUS RTU. Configuration Manual. HART transparent driver. No. 9107MCM100(1328)

Section TELEPHONE AUTOMATIC DIALER SYSTEM

1.Eastron SDM220Modbus Smart Meter Modbus Protocol Implementation V1.0

Modbus Protocol. PDF format version of the MODBUS Protocol. The original was found at:

Modicon Modbus Protocol Reference Guide. PI MBUS 300 Rev. J

S4000TH HART. HART Communication Manual

NC-12 Modbus Application

Process Control and Automation using Modbus Protocol

Data Bulletin. Communications Wiring for POWERLINK G3 Systems Class 1210 ABOUT THIS BULLETIN APPLICATION INTRODUCTION.

Master-Touch and ValuMass. Modbus Communications. INSTRUCTION MANUAL (Rev. 2.1)

White Paper. Technical Capabilities of the DF1 Half-Duplex Protocol

RcWare SoftPLC Modbus server mapping editor User manual

Develop a Dallas 1-Wire Master Using the Z8F1680 Series of MCUs

RS-232 Communications Using BobCAD-CAM. RS-232 Introduction

TCP/IP MODULE CA-ETHR-A INSTALLATION MANUAL

TX2123 RS485 TO ETHERNET ADAPTOR

DOORKING SYSTEMS 1830 SERIES NETWORK WORKSHOP LAN APPLICATIONS ACCESS CONTROL SOLUTIONS LOCAL AREA NETWORK (LAN) CONNECTION REV 04.

EDI Distributor Control Interface Wiring and Setup Instructions

Technical Note A007 Modbus Gateway Vantage Pro2 25/09/2009 Rev. A 1 de 7

Single channel data transceiver module WIZ2-434

SMS GSM Alarm Messenger

Temperature & Humidity SMS Alert Controller

DIALER SPECIFICATION VERBATIM MODULAR SERIES VSS

PowerLogic Sub Meter Display (SMD and SMDOPN)

1-Port R422/485 Serial PCIe Card

IO Expansion Module User & Installation Manual

PNSPO! Modbus Solution CP1H / CP1L / CJ1 / CJ2 / CS1. Version /18/2009

MTS Master Custom Communications Protocol APPLICATION NOTES

Appendix B RCS11 Remote Communications

ProLink II Software for Micro Motion Transmitters

IP Link Device Interface Communication Sheet

SUPERtrol II Flow Computer

Date Rev. Details Author

RS485 & Modbus Protocol Guide

IntesisBox KNX Modbus RTU master

Web Datalogger. Unit RS232C. General-purpose modem RS485. IP address search screen

CENTRONICS interface and Parallel Printer Port LPT

INTRODUCTION FEATURES OF THE ICM

Accessing Diagnostics using a Dialup Modem

EZ-View Network Communications Guide

MAKING MODERN LIVING POSSIBLE. AK-SC255 On-Site Installation Guide DANFOSS ELECTRONIC CONTROLS & SENSORS

ALL-USB-RS422/485. User Manual. USB to Serial Converter RS422/485. ALLNET GmbH Computersysteme Alle Rechte vorbehalten

Modbus Tutorial 7/30/01. Tutorial on TTDM-PLUS and TTSIM System Integration using Modbus

TRP-C31M MODBUS TCP to RTU/ASCII Gateway

IntesisBox ASCII Server - LON

Digital and Analog I/O

OPT SERIAL TO FIBER OPTIC CONVERTER

EnerVista TM Viewpoint Monitoring v7.10

Computer Control of Satellite Antennas

sip Sanyo Modbus Guide Technical Specification Pinouts, Cable Connections & Wiring Issue 2: February 2009 Synapsys Solutions Ltd, all rights reserved

Environment Temperature Control Using Modbus and RS485 Communication Standards

Temp. & humidity Transmitter Instructions

MBP_MSTR: Modbus Plus Master 12

8 data bits, least significant bit sent first 1 bit for even/odd parity (or no parity) 1 stop bit if parity is used; 1 or 2 bits if no parity

FAST TUTORIALS FOR TIME-CHALLENGED TECHNICIANS

2. Terminal arrangement. Default (PV display) (SV display) Communication protocol selection Selects the Communication protocol. Modbus ASCII mode:

PROFIBUS AND MODBUS: A COMPARISON

USER GUIDE. Ethernet Configuration Guide (Lantronix) P/N: Rev 6

Programming Flash Microcontrollers through the Controller Area Network (CAN) Interface

ModBus Server - KNX. Gateway for integration of KNX equipment into Modbus (RTU and TCP) control systems.

User Manual Revision English

Programming and Using the Courier V.Everything Modem for Remote Operation of DDF6000

Premium Server Client Software

Panasonic/Sanyo A/C Interface Modbus RTU Installation Instructions

WEB log. Device connection plans

How To Set Up A Modbus Cda On A Pc Or Maca (Powerline) With A Powerline (Powergen) And A Powergen (Powerbee) (Powernet) (Operating System) (Control Microsci

User Manual Revision English Converter / Adapter Ethernet to RS232 / RS485 (Order Code: HD HD M HD HD M)

Enron (AGA7) Modbus Protocol

isco Connecting Routers Back to Back Through the AUX P

PLC Master / Slave Example

ESPA Nov 1984 PROPOSAL FOR SERIAL DATA INTERFACE FOR PAGING EQUIPMENT CONTENTS 1. INTRODUCTION 2. CHARACTER DESCRIPTION

PCS0100en Persy Control Services B.V. Netherlands

PRT3 Printer Module: ASCII Protocol Programming Instructions

Documentation. M-Bus 130-mbx

ENET-710. ENET Ethernet Module ENET-710 JAN / 06 FOUNDATION

JetStream RS-232 Bridge

RS-422/485 Multiport Serial PCI Card. RS-422/485 Multiport Serial PCI Card Installation Guide

How to setup a serial Bluetooth adapter Master Guide

ATS Communication Overview

When we look at the connector pinout of the RS232 port, we see two pins which are certainly used

AutoWAVE. Programming Instructions P/N Part of Thermo Fisher Scientific. Revision D

For support on the Beijer HMI please contact:

Paragon Explorer Lite Communication Software

RS232 Programming and Troubleshooting Guide for Turbo Controls

LTM-1338B. Plus Communications Manual

ROC Protocol Specifications Manual

IP Link Device Interface Communication Sheet

IntesisBox KNX Modbus TCP master

SMS Alarm Messenger. Setup Software Guide. SMSPro_Setup. Revision [Version 2.2]

Nemo 96HD/HD+ MODBUS

ATC-300+ Modbus Communications Guide

MODBUS TCP to RTU/ASCII Gateway

Transcription:

SUPERtrol-I RS-485 Option with Modbus RTU Protocol http://www.kep.com KESSLER-ELLIS PRODUCTS 10 Industrial Way East Eatontown, NJ 07724 800-631-2165 732-935-1320 Fax: 732-935-9344 99657 09/01/04

Introducing SUPERtrol-I with RS-485 & Modbus RTU Protocol When the SUPERtrol-I is equipped with the RS-485 communication option, the protocol it uses is the Modbus RTU protocol. This protocol defines a message structure that hosts and clients will recognize and use on the RS-485 network over which they communicate. It describes the process a master device (PC compatible) uses to request access to another device (SUPERtrol-I), how it will respond to requests from the other devices, and how errors will be detected and reported. It establishes a common format for the layout and contents of message fields. During communications on a Modbus RTU network, the protocol determines how each SUPERtrol-I will know its device address, recognize a message addressed to it, determine the kind of action to be taken, and extract any data or other information contained in the message. If a reply is required, the SUPERtrol-I will construct the reply message and send it using Modbus RTU protocol. RTU Mode The SUPERtrol-I with RS-485 communications option supports the Modbus RTU (Remote Terminal Unit) mode only. The Modbus ASCII mode is not supported. The main advantage of the RTU mode is that its greater character density allows better data throughput than ASCII for the same baud rate. The Modbus RTU uses a Master-Slave Query-Response Cycle in which the SUPERtrol-I is the slave device. Control Functions The SUPERtrol-I with RS-485 communications option supports the following function codes: CODE NAME DESCRIPTION 01 Read Coil Status Read a single coil 03 Read Holding Register Read a range of holding registers 05 Force Single Coil Forces a single coil (0x reference) to either ON or OFF 06 Preset Single Register Presets a value into a single holding register (4x reference) 15 Force Multiple Coil Forces each coil (0x reference) in a sequence of coils to either ON or OFF 16 Preset Multiple Registers Presets values into a sequence of holding registers (4x reference) 1

SUPERtrol-I RS-485 Port Pinout (recommended mating connector: DB-9M) 5 4 3 2 1 9 8 7 6 1 Ground 2 Ground 3 Ground 4 TX/RX (+) 5 TX/RX (-) 6 Do Not Use 7 Terminating Resistor (180 Ω) 8 TX/RX (+) (spare internally connected to 4) 9 TX/RX (-) (spare internally connected to 5) RS-232 5 9 4 8 3 7 2 6 1 RS-485 5 9 4 8 3 7 2 6 1 1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 18 19 20 21 22 23 24 SUPERtrol-I RS-485 Port Pinout (Terminal Block Option) 1 Common 2 TX/RX (+) 3 TX/RX (-) 4 Terminating Resistor (180Ω) RS-485 RS-232 1 2 3 4 5 4 3 2 1 9 8 7 6 1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 18 19 20 21 22 23 24 Installation Overview A two wire RS-485 may be multidropped up to 4000 ft. and up to 32 units may be chained together. A RS- 485 to RS-232 interface adapter is required at the PC. An optically isolated type is recommended. Suitable wiring should be selected based on anticipated electrical interference. Terminators should be used to help improve the quality of electronic signals sent over the RS-485 wires. The RS-485 chain should be terminated at the beginning (RS-485 adaptor) and at the last device in the RS-485 chain and nowhere else. On the SUPERtrol-I this is accomplished by connecting a jumper from terminal 7 to terminal 4 or 8 at the RS- 485 port when DB-9 connector is used. Place jumper between terminals 2 and 4 when the terminal block option is used. If lightning protection is required, a suitable surge protector should be used. For additional information, refer to the technical requirements of EIA-485, interface adaptor user manual and the communication software user manual SUPERtrol-I Communication Setup Menu The setup menu allows Modbus RTU Protocol communications parameters of: Device ID, Baud Rate, and Parity to be selected to match the parameters of your RS-485 network. Each SUPERtrol-I must have it s own Device ID and the same Baud Rate and Parity setting. 2

Register & Coil Usage Register Usage (each register is 2 bytes) SUPERtrol-I Data Register Data Type Access Volume Flow Reg 40001 & 40002 Float Read CorVol or Mass Flow Reg 40003 & 40004 Float Read Total Reg 40005 & 40006 Float Read Grand Total Reg 40007 & 40008 Float Read Temperature Reg 40009 & 40010 Float Read Density Reg 40011 & 40012 Float Read Preset 1 Reg 40013 & 40014 Float Read/Write Preset 2 Reg 40015 & 40016 Float Read/Write Preset 3 Reg 40017 & 40018 Float Read/Write Preset 4 Reg 40019 & 40020 Float Read/Write Year Reg 40021 Integer Read Month Reg 40022 Integer Read Day Reg 40023 Integer Read Hours Reg 40024 Integer Read Minutes Reg 40025 Integer Read Seconds Reg 40026 Integer Read Viscosity Reg 40027 & 40028 Float Read Transaction Number Reg 40029 Integer Read Unused Reg 40030 Unused Reg 40031 & 40032 Unused Reg 40033 & 40034 Unused Reg 40035 & 40036 Unused Reg 40037 & 40038 Unused Reg 40039 & 40040 Unused Reg 40041 & 40042 Unused Reg 40043 & 40044 Fluid Number Reg 40045 Integer Read/Write Unused Reg 40046 Unused Reg 40047 & 40048 Unused Reg 40049 & 40050 Unused Reg 40051 & 40052 Unused Reg 40053 & 40054 Unused Reg 40055 & 40056 Unused Reg 40057 & 40058 Unused Reg 40059 & 40060 Unused Reg 40061 & 40062 Unused Reg 40063 & 40064 NOTE: The Float data type follows the IEEE format for a 32 bit float. COIL USAGE (each coil is 1 bit) SUPERtrol-I Data Coil Data Type Access Error-Pulse Out Overflow Coil 00001 bit Read Alarm-Flow Rate Alarm Low Coil 00002 bit Read Alarm-Flow Rate Alarm High Coil 00003 bit Read Alarm-Temp Alarm Low Coil 00004 bit Read Alarm-Temp Alarm High Coil 00005 bit Read Alarm-Density Alarm Low Coil 00006 bit Read Alarm-Density Alarm High Coil 00007 bit Read Unused Coil 00008 Unused Coil 00009 Unused Coil 00010 Unused Coil 00011 Unused Coil 00012 Coil 00013 3

Register & Coil Usage (continued) SUPERtrol-I Data Coil Data Type Access Alarm-Batch Overrun Alarm Coil 00014 bit Read Error-Software Error Reset Coil 00015 bit Read Error-Extended PFI Lockup Coil 00016 bit Read Unused Coil 00017 Unused Coil 00018 Error-Cal Checksum Error Coil 00019 bit Read Error-Modem Not Found Coil 00020 bit Read Error-Setup Checksum Error Coil 00021 bit Read Error-Rate Overflow Error Coil 00022 bit Read Error-A to D Not Converting Coil 00023 bit Read Error-Aux Input Too Low Coil 00024 bit Read Error-Aux Input Too High Coil 00025 bit Read Error-Flow Input Too Low Coil 00026 bit Read Error-Flow Input Too High Coil 00027 bit Read Error-Pulse Security Error Coil 00028 bit Read Error-RTD Out Of Range Coil 00029 bit Read Warning-Battery Low Warning Coil 00030 bit Read Error-Time Clock Error Coil 00031 bit Read Warning-Totalizer Rollover Coil 00032 bit Read Command-Reset Total Coil 00033 bit Read/Write Command-Reset Errors Coil 00034 bit Read/Write Command-Print Command Coil 00035 bit Read/Write Status-Instrument Type Rate/Total or Batch Coil 00036 bit Read Command-Start Batch Command* Coil 00037 bit Read/Write Command-Stop Batch Command* Coil 00038 bit Read/Write Command-Clear Batch Command* Coil 00039 bit Read/Write Status-Batch Filling Status* Coil 00040 bit Read Status-Batch Stopped Status* Coil 00041 bit Read Status-Batch Idle Status* Coil 00042 bit Read Command-Relay 1 Command** Coil 00043 bit Read/Write Command-Relay 2 Command** Coil 00044 bit Read/Write Command-Relay 3 Command** Coil 00045 bit Read/Write Command-Relay 4 Command** Coil 00046 bit Read/Write Status-Relay 1 Status Coil 00047 bit Read Status-Relay 2 Status Coil 00048 bit Read Status-Relay 3 Status Coil 00049 bit Read Status-Relay 4 Status Coil 00050 bit Read Status-Control 1 Status Coil 00051 bit Read Status-Control 2 Status Coil 00052 bit Read Status-Control 3 Status Coil 00053 bit Read Unused Coil 00054 Unused Coil 00055 Unused Coil 00056 Unused Coil 00057 Unused Coil 00058 Unused Coil 00059 Unused Coil 00060 Unused Coil 00061 Unused Coil 00062 Unused Coil 00063 Unused Coil 00064 * Batch functions are only active if unit has been configured as a batcher in the setup menus. Instrument Type Rate/Total or Batch status is 0 for RT, 1 for Batch. ** Relay commands are only active if relays have been configured for NA (not assigned) in the setup menus.